Health is a diverse topic that would take years and years to discuss and finish. The hormones in the bodies of human beings play important roles in initiating some biological reactions in the body. Most scientists define them as chemical messengers that induce transfer of chemical substances and reactions in the body. When their levels escalate or drop drastically, they cause biological hitches in the body. To keep this in check, it is important to know how to balance hormones in women naturally for healthier lives.

There are natural ways that a woman should use to ensure that the levels of these chemical messengers are optimum. The first natural method is avoiding stress. When you are stressed, you body secrets cortisol hormone that raises their levels in the body. Those who are active in the yoga activities and meditation experience less hormonal swings. A woman who lives a hectic lifestyle has little to relax and is not able to adjust from the hefty demands of life.

Women have become busier that they have no time for relaxing their body and mind at night. This is due to the economical demands they influence especially the single parents. While all this is important and sense making, it is prudent to give yourself ample time for sleeping since this is the only time your body can recuperate from most activities of the day. Sleeping less than eight hours a day could detriment your hormonal system.

The types of foods you eat are important, but you should evaluate their nutritive values to ensure they benefit your body. Most people have become busy that they do not prepare food at home, but prefer buying processed food. To keep your hormonal level stabilized as a woman, you will need to stay away from food substances such as enriched flavor, soft drinks, processed vegetable oils, and fried foods.

Physical exercise is demanding, but crucial to your body. Nevertheless, only a few people know its importance. Most of the people do it for the sake of relaxation without knowing the deeper scientific principles behind it. Going to the field with your exercise kit to jog and do other physical activities is an effective way of dealing with hormonal swings.

It is not harmful to burst in the sun for a while in course of the day. This will be helpful in keeping your hormone levels stable. Many people associate sunrays with all negative attitudes, but they are important in some instances. They supply you vitamin D that eventually help in checking any hormonal changes.

Another way is asking your doctor to prescribe the natural supplements you should take to regulate hormonal levels. The physician can advise you on the supplements that contain large quantities of vitamin B complex, vitamin C, and vitamin E. You may also need to take supplements rich in minerals like magnesium and calcium.

Taking much water is critical for your body and the reactions that occur in it. It is not good to wait until you are thirsty to take water. You should take it regularly to keep your hormonal system checked. The water you take eliminates most of the toxins in the body.
